WebDec 30, 2012 · 34) add that effective interprofessional working should involve: recognition and acceptance of the need for doing things together; clarity and realism of purpose; commitment and ownership; trust; clear and robust practical arrangements; opportunities to review and learn. Webpower in interprofessional education, practice, and research. Given the continued drive toward integrated and collaborative healthcare systems, theoretical as well as practical tools are required to explore the dynamics of power and their effects on interprofessional working across disciplines and domains. Collaborating with and supporting staff will demand skills in managing and leading people, role modelling and negotiation at the frontline of care. The matron should use their clinical experience and academic knowledge and seek support from their senior management team for this.
